What can the grant be used for?

The Welsh Small Grants Efficiency Scheme supports capital investments in equipment and technology that have been pre-identified as offering clear and quantifiable benefits to your farm business. The capital items have been specified, along with a referenced cost for each item.

Who can apply?

  • You must are registered with the Welsh Government and have been issued with a Customer Reference Number (CRN).
  • You must be a primary producer of agricultural products
  • have 3ha of eligible agricultural land registered with RPW in Wales or
  • be able to demonstrate over 550 standard labour hours

The primary production of agricultural products includes the following farming sectors: arable, beef, dairy, goats, horticulture (including hydroponics and aquaponics), pigs, poultry, sheep, apiculture.

You are not eligible if:

  • you are an equine customer (including grazing horses)
  • you are a forestry customer (including woodland only owners)
  • a group of farmers (including Producer Organisations) however, if two or more agricultural holdings are managed as a single unit, or in a single ownership, or to some extent have common management, common financial accounts, common livestock, machinery and/or feeding stores that will be classed as a single business.
  • You must not use items purchased through Small Grants – Efficiency for agricultural contracting activities.
